Fixed rough idle on 22re!

My engine used to idle terribly. Today I replaced my thermostat and found that the wire going to the top of the temp sending unit on the t-stat was broke. I cut off the old connector and crimped on a female end instead and plugged it in. When I started my truck to check for leaks, I found that it idled much better. Just thought I would let you guys know in case you have the same problem.
